<p style="text-align: center;"><b>HTH Blitzes Anaheim; Garners Media Hits</b></p>
<p>Last week, Hotels that Help President Jim Abrams presented our program to more than 400 Southern California hoteliers at the California Hotel &amp; Lodging Association and Asian American Hotel Owners Association Conference.</p>
<p>The HTH logo adorned all the event signage and was featured prominently in the &#8221; USA Today promotional materials handed out to all participants. The Hotels that Help team also swarmed the trade show and luncheon in our distinctive HTH t-shirts, passing out information and making contact with hoteliers.</p>
<p>As part of our outreach efforts, we also sent out a press release announcing Jim as our leader and our goal of enrolling 1,000 hotels to raise $10 million annually in California. We got 24-hour coverage at sites like CNBC, Yahoo!, Hospitality.net, and are working with other outlets for more durable, in-depth coverage as well. Stay tuned&#8230;.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><b>Website Supports Hoteliers, Charities from Interest to Rollout</b></p>
<p>Based on the experience of the people, hotels, and charities who pioneered the Hotels that Help program, our web-based support system enables an interested hotelier to get a guest-giving program up and running at her/his hotel&#8211;without the assistance or management of the HTH staff (of course, we will help out if needed!).</p>
<p>By simplifying the operation of a Hotels that Help program, and empowering local management, we enable the HTH movement to &#8220;go viral.&#8221; The success of HtH depends on our ability to support a &#8220;scalable&#8221; model, where thousands of hotels can run HTH programs supporting thousands of local charities, without a bulky bureaucracy &#8220;running&#8221;  each program from a central office.</p>
